London Co. of Virginia Sells 60,106 Shares of UniFirst Corporation $UNF

London Co. of Virginia cut its holdings in shares of UniFirst Corporation (NYSE:UNFFree Report) by 7.2%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 775,264 shares of the textile maker’s stock after selling 60,106 shares during the quarter. London Co. of Virginia’s holdings in UniFirst were worth $195,052,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

A number of other large investors have also added to or reduced their stakes in UNF. Gabelli Funds LLC bought a new stake in shares of UniFirst during the 1st quarter valued at $277,000. Gamco Investors INC. ET AL acquired a new position in UniFirst in the first quarter valued at about $868,000. Arrowstreet Capital Limited Partnership acquired a new position in UniFirst in the first quarter valued at about $3,805,000. Caxton Associates LLP bought a new position in UniFirst in the first quarter valued at approximately $15,161,000. Finally, Levin Capital Strategies L.P. increased its stake in shares of UniFirst by 119.1% in the 1st quarter. Levin Capital Strategies L.P. now owns 55,921 shares of the textile maker’s stock valued at $14,069,000 after purchasing an additional 30,402 shares during the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 78.17% of the company’s stock.

UniFirst Stock Performance

Shares of NYSE:UNF opened at $293.86 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$5.31 billion, a P/E ratio of 46.35 and a beta of 0.63. The company’s 50-day moving average is $270.65 and its 200 day moving average is $250.74. UniFirst Corporation has a fifty-two week low of $147.66 and a fifty-two week high of $295.60.

UniFirst (NYSE:UNFG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 1st. The textile maker reported $1.09 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.93 by ($0.84). The business had revenue of $634.40 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$627.66 million. UniFirst had a net margin of 4.65% and a return on equity of 6.44%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 3.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ted $2.13 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ts predict that UniFirst Corporation will post 7.49 earnings per share for the current year.

UniFirst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 25th. Investors of record on Friday, September 4th will be issued a dividend of $0.365 per share. This represents a $1.46 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.5%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, September 4th. UniFirst’s dividend payout ratio is currently 23.03%.

UniFirst Corporation (NYSE: UNF) is a leading provider of customized uniform rental and facility service programs in North America and Europe. The company specializes in the rental, laundering and maintenance of workwear, corporate apparel and protective garments for a broad range of industries, including manufacturing, automotive, hospitality, healthcare and food processing. UniFirst also offers a suite of facility service products such as entrance mats, restroom supplies, wipers, mops and hygienic services designed to help customers maintain clean and safe environments.

In addition to its core uniform rental business, UniFirst has expanded its product portfolio to include safety and first-responder gear, flame-resistant clothing, high-visibility apparel and personal protective equipment (PPE).
